2015 Dutton Goldfield Chardonnay "Dutton Ranch"

Dutton Goldfield 2015 Dutton Ranch Chardonnay

Winery: Dutton Goldfield

Vintage: 2015

Wine Name/Vineyard: "Dutton Ranch"

Wine Category: Chardonnay

Grape blend: 100% Chardonnay

Bottle size: 750 ml

Region: Russian River Valley

State or country: CA

Price: $38

Cases produced: 4,018

KWG Score: 91.7 (based on 4 reviews)

Ken's Wine Rating: Very Good+ (91)

Review date: November 21, 2017

Wine Review: This light yellow colored Chardonnay from Dutton Goldfield opens with a fragrant golden delicious apple bouquet with a hint of lemon and pear. On the palate, this wine is medium bodied and balanced. The flavor profile is and toasted oak influenced baked apple with notes of pineapple. I also detected hints of lemon verbena. The finish is dry and its flavors linger and last for quite some time. Fans of California-styled Chard will enjoy this wine. I would pair this Chard with toasted ravioli. Enjoy - Ken

Winemaker Notes: Our 2015 Dutton Ranch Chardonnay shows this liveliness right away in the nose, leading with zesty lime, Meyer lemon and tangerine, backed by more sultry notes of lemon oil and roasted nuts. The mouth is fresh with citrus, yet has a luscious creaminess at the same time. The initial lemon/lime hit is followed by rounder flavors of pear and green apple, along with a touch of apricot. The finish is brisk and refreshing, with a dash of toasty chestnut. The delicious chardonnay's bright/rich combination make it the perfect match or counterpoint to a wide range of foods, with shellfish in a cream sauce the ultimate echo of the wine's qualities.
